Summary
In the current Service Desk setup, the adding customers to the project comes together as a functionality for the Service Desk Team project role in the JIRA Service Desk project. There is no way, to separate the adding customer access separately, the user would like to create a new level of permission or administrative user that only has access to only adding/removing the customer.
Expected Results
To be able to have a permission or project role/administrative group that allows the user to be able to only add customer to the JIRA Service Desk project
Actual Results
The Service Desk Team role gives the user multiple other functionalities apart from adding customers.
